What is the IELTS Test?
The IELTS test is collectively managed by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. It is designed to assess the English language skills of non-native speakers and is accepted by over 10,000 organizations worldwide, including universities, companies, and immigration authorities. There are 2 main types of IELTS tests:
IELTS Academic: Suitable for people who wish to study at a higher education level or for professional registration.IELTS General Training: Appropriate for those who wish to move to an English-speaking nation or look for work experience or training programs.
Both variations of the test cover the exact same four skills-- listening, reading, composing, and speaking-- but the material and format differ slightly to accommodate various functions.
Test Format
The IELTS test is divided into 4 areas:
Listening: 40 minutes, consisting of 4 tape-recorded texts with 40 concerns.Reading: 60 minutes, with three passages and 40 questions. The texts are more academic in nature for the IELTS Academic test, while the buy genuine Ielts Certificate online General Training test includes texts from books, magazines, and newspapers.Writing: 60 minutes, with 2 tasks. Task 1 of the IELTS Academic test involves explaining a chart, table, chart, or diagram, while Task 1 of the IELTS General Training test involves composing a letter. Task 2 for both variations requires composing an essay.Speaking: 11-14 minutes, performed as a face-to-face interview with an inspector. Q: What is the distinction between IELTS Academic and IELTS General Training?
A: The IELTS Academic test is developed for people who wish to study at a college level or for professional registration. It consists of academic texts and tasks. The IELTS General Training test appropriates for those who wish to move to an English-speaking country or get work experience or training programs. It includes texts and jobs that are more useful and daily in nature.
Q: How long are the results valid?
A: IELTS outcomes are typically valid for 2 years. However, some institutions and organizations may have different credibility durations, so it’s important to check their specific requirements.

Q: How are the scores reported?
A: IELTS scores are reported on a scale from 0 to 9. Each band corresponds to a level of English efficiency. The overall band score is the average of the 4 private ratings, rounded to the nearest half or entire band.
